Operation



When it pertains to the surgery for oral implants, it is very important for you to comprehend what'll happen throughout the surgical treatment. Here's a breakdown of what you can anticipate:

1. Anesthetic: Prior to the surgical procedure starts, you'll get anesthesia to numb the area where the implant will certainly be placed. This guarantees you will not feel any kind of discomfort throughout the treatment.

2. Incision: The dental surgeon will certainly make a tiny incision in your gum tissue to reveal the jawbone. This allows them to create a room for the implant.

3. Implant Positioning: The implant, which is a little titanium message, will after that be thoroughly placed into the jawbone. This works as the structure for your brand-new tooth.



4. Healing: After the implant is positioned, your periodontal cells will be stitched back with each other. Over the next couple of months, the implant will fuse with the jawbone through a process called osseointegration.

Healing Period



Throughout the recuperation duration, you can expect some discomfort and swelling in the location where the dental implant was positioned. This is a typical part of the recovery process and need to go away within a couple of days.
